    The location was extremely convenient. We walked to everything. The room was filled with antiques, very authentic. It was very quiet. The bathroom was quite large. Lots of toiletries were provided. A fridge in the hallway had bottled water and soft drinks. In the morning, there was coffee outside our room. Our room was ready early for us.

    Our stay was perfect...I can't think of a single thing that was lacking. Blake and Melanie are wonderful hosts, always willing to help in any way. My husband was riding the Mickelson Trail and needed a place to keep his bike where it would be safe. They accommodated his need cheerfully, providing a safe storage place. They are very knowledgeable about the area's history and willing to chat about what they know. A perfect stay.

    This hotel has been beautifully restored with lovely antiques, beautiful colors and tasteful decor throughout. The rooms are on the floor above the small casino below, so it is quiet and restful. There is a delightful cafe adjacent to the casino on the ground floor, offering wonderful breakfasts served by cheerful, friendly staff.
